Output 3bbf3643a29def450b08dd9fcd43b4aeaab9f7dec1d1c6d77c0ad7cd2900c31a:0

value
10409169
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7eec6534f6972aa1b0e5a9c048512de6ed39cb14 OP_EQUAL
address
3DG8FkUzsiari6hjVRMmKnnZwTqfaKsU3S
transaction
3bbf3643a29def450b08dd9fcd43b4aeaab9f7dec1d1c6d77c0ad7cd2900c31a
spent
true